Fort Saint-André
This fortress was built by Jean le Bon, King of France, in the 14th century,
to protect the Abbey and the Saint-André area.
You can visit the twin towers, the Tour des Masques, and the Romanesque chapel of Notre Dame de Belvezet.
From the walkway around the fort, you have magnificent views over Ville neuve, Avignon, the Rhône valley, Mont-Vento
